This document discusses shifting from a transactional to a transformational mindset in libraries. It provides examples of how libraries describe themselves in transactional terms, such as providing resources, versus transformational terms focused on empowering communities. The document advocates challenging existing mental models and using questions to minimize risk and expand thinking. It contrasts finite and infinite models of power, and suggests developing ideas that could transform library programs and services.
